#2: Switch

Best Jewelry Subscription Boxes

Luxury goods and designer dupes operate on opposite sides of the same spectrum. There’s something intrinsically shameful in wearing a counterfeit. On the other hand, opting for authenticity can entail a hefty bill and hard-hitting regret. 

Switch, a rental company founded by Liana Kadisha Cohn and Adriel Darvish believed that haute couture should be accessible to everyone; especially true when it comes to jewelry. 

Established in 2016, this Californian-based brand offers a wide assortment of designer jewelry. This includes earrings, necklaces, and bracelets made by Chanel, Hermès, Gucci, and Christian Dior. 

To sign up, customers must choose from 3 subscription plans that vary in cost and product amount. To keep things easy to read, this best jewelry subscription boxes review will share the deets down below:

  • The Gold plan: 1 piece for $40/per month (earns $5 per term in credit)
  • The Platinum plan: 2 pieces for $70/per month (earns $7 per term in credit)
  • The Black plan: 3 pieces for $90/per month (earns $10 per term in credit) 

Members can choose the jewelry they’d like to be delivered. When it’s time to ‘Switch’ up your look, customers can exchange their pieces free of charge. 

Ultimately, it’s a great option for trendsetters who want to jump on the haute couture bandwagon on reasonable terms. Considering that some designer jewelry can retail as high as $2,000, we’d say Switch is a pretty good deal!

#5: Vivrelle 

Best Jewelry Subscription Boxes

Want to be a high-profile trendsetter? Vivrelle offers the finesse of luxury shopping without the worry of overspending. You can thank founder Blake Geffen, who thought it necessary to implement accessibility and affordability in the world of designer-brand goods. 

Since 2018, Viverelle has continued to offer the crème-de-la-crème of haute couture jewelry and purses. This rental program has been highlighted by various media outlets, including Who What Wear and InStyle magazine. 

Interested to know what they’ve got? Members can peruse through celebrity-fashioned labels such as Fendi, Louis Vuitton, Gucci, Balenciaga, and Prada. 

Compared to the best jewelry subscription boxes we’ve featured so far, Vivrelle provides a vast amount of flexibility for its membership plans. If you need the deets, we’ll summarize them in a neat point-form list down below:

  • The Premier plan: $39 per month (contains 1 item with the inclusion of jewelry. Retail value is estimated at $1,000)
  • The Classique plan: $99 per month (contains 1 item per term. Retail value is estimated at $4,000)
  • The Couture plan: $199 per month (contains 1 item per term from the Classique or Couture collection. Involves limited edition pieces and offers a retail value worth over $4,000)
  • The Couture plan: $279 per month (contains 2 items per term from the Classique and Couture collection) 

It’s worth noting that customers can choose when they’d like to pay, as installments range from every month, 3-month, 6-month, or a yearly basis. 

Yes, it’s one of the pricier best jewelry subscription boxes we’ve covered, but considering the retail value for each price—it’s definitely a steal when all plans are under $1,000. If you aren’t gelling with a certain piece, customers can exchange their designs free of charge. 

Viverelle is a solid membership plan for budget-conscious fashion enthusiasts who want more than just jewelry. I mean, can you imagine wearing a Celine handbag and a pair of Chanel earrings for under $279? Talk about a humblebrag.

How to Choose the Best Jewelry Subscription Boxes

Best Jewelry Subscription Boxes

If you encountered a brand that wasn’t included in this best jewelry subscription boxes lineup, there are a few ways to distinguish authenticity from poor-quality counterfeits. It requires some detective-like investigating on your part. 

Is the brand credible? What materials do they use? How many pieces do you get each month? Ultimately, these questions can help determine a reputable brand. 

Below, this best jewelry subscription boxes review will provide a rundown of pointers to consider when choosing a brand. 

Brand  

Brand recognition isn’t enough to guarantee the legitimacy of a company. A good jeweler should be transparent and informative when sharing details concerning product quality, sourcing, and manufacturing practices. 

On top of that, it’s usually a good sign if they’re relatively active on social media. If the brand regularly engages with its audience, you know that they genuinely care. 

Quality

When it comes to jewelry, quality is indicative of materials and level of hand craftsmanship. A good brand should offer hypoallergenic alternatives and pieces that are free of lead and nickel. Intricately designed bling usually denotes a high degree of expertise—but that doesn’t mean the minimalistic styles are emblematic of poor manufacturing practices. 

Quantity

So, are you an occasional jewelry-wearer, or do you consider your outfit incomplete without a few necklaces, bracelets, and rings? Before settling on a subscription brand, customers should consider how often they use bling. Some companies only deliver one piece per month, while others provide 20 trinkets each term. 

Frequency

The best jewelry subscription boxes operate on a monthly basis. But, as you’ve probably already noticed, most memberships are flexible. Some bundles only ship on a bi or tri-monthly basis. In addition, customers can also choose how long they’d like to keep their subscription plans for, as this can range from a 3-month, 6-month, or yearly term. 

Style

Jewelry comes in a variety of shapes and sizes. Do you prefer minimalist silhouettes, or do you love to make a statement? Aside from price, it’s important to evaluate your style preferences before settling on a brand. For instance, some companies only cater to bohemian designs, while others lean towards subtle and dainty jewelry. 

Extras 

Everybody loves a freebie. While it’s unnecessary for all companies to include complementary items, it’s always a plus. I mean, how can you say no to a free caramel candy from mintMONGOOSE or handmade soap from Your Bijoux Box? 

Cost

Quantity and price go hand-in-hand. Rental services like Switch and Vivrelle will charge a higher fee considering that they offer designer jewelry. More often than not, indie brands like mintMONGOOSE and EarFleek will offer a lower cost for their products. 

At the end of the day, It’s important to assess your overall budget and how often you wear jewelry when choosing a company.
